Learning & Development Associate - Digital L&D Specialist

The Programme

Learning & Development (“L&D”) is responsible for the development of our people within KPMG and our purpose are:

  • To equip our people with the knowledge, skills, and attitude to provide our clients with insights, innovative thinking and ability to resolve their most complex problems. 
  • To provide world class learning and development framework and tools, and timely and insightful reports to our key stakeholders to help them effectively manage their people’s growth and development.

The Learning & Development Associate reports to the L&D Assistant Manager and L&D Director, and key roles include:

  • Collaboration with a team of instructional designers and developers who are passionate about utilizing technologies to enhance learning experiences and increase learning effectiveness; and 
  • Collaboration with various business units and their respective subject matter experts.

What You Will Do

  • Works closely with and supports the Digital L&D Specialist team in the design and development of interactive and engaging web-based learning and eLearning contents through digital authoring tools and various technological enablers trending in digital learning. 
  • Consistently delivers high quality work to meet internal clients’ needs.  
  • Builds positive and collaborative working relationships to drive collaboration and inclusion. 
  • Identifies learning-related issues, such as content sequencing, flow of information and relevancy of media, and suggests ways to implement effective solutions. 
  • Research learning industry trends, methodologies, and technology and makes recommendations to instructional designers and developers and/or subject matter experts on how to incorporate trends into digital learning. 
  • Provides innovative solutions related to the design and development of digital learning contents. 
  • Recommends most effective deployment approach based on knowledge and experience in incorporating theories of adult learning, interactive learning methods and relevant assessments. 
  • Responsible for updating existing digital learning contents due to changes arising from processes, methodology or subject contents as highlighted by the instructional designers and developers and/or subject matter experts.  
  • Documents and follows up on problems encountered in the course of work and recommends appropriate solutions. 
  • Learns and be coached on how to use Articulate Storyline 3.0 for the development of digital learning contents.  
  • Be involved in the development and implementation of digital learning and development strategies and objectives of L&D. 
  • Be involved in Asia Pacific Learning & Development’s digital L&D projects/initiatives for implementation in KPMG Malaysia. 
  • Be involved in People projects initiated by the People, Performance and Culture team from time to time. 
  • Day-to-day responsibilities and tasks within the department as the L&D Associate.

Required Skills and Abilities

  • Candidate must possess at least a Degree in Multimedia Design, Digital Media Technology or equivalent.   
  • Relevant work experience in the area of digital learning & development is an advantage 
  • Good command of English. 
  • Good interpersonal skills, strong verbal and written communication skills, with a pleasant personality. 
  • Self-motivated and able to work independently. 
  • Good time management and prioritization skills to meet project timelines. 
  • Strong team collaboration and problem-solving skills. 
  • Passionate about developing digital learning contents and materials. 
  • Strong multimedia skills with an eye for detail and thoroughness. 
  • Must be computer savvy and proficient in Microsoft Excel, MS Word, MS Outlook and MS Power Point.
